Embodiment 1

[0025] Weigh lidocaine and n-octyl p-hydroxybenzoate respectively according to the molar ratio of 1:0.25~3, then put the mixture in a round bottom flask, stir for 0.25~4h under the heating condition of 40~80℃ to form uniform clarification Transparent liquid, i.e. hydrophobic deep eutectic solvent.

Embodiment 2

[0027] Weigh a certain amount of the hydrophobic deep eutectic solvent synthesized in Example 1 respectively in a certain amount of Rhodamine B aqueous solution whose concentration is 10 mg / L. Under the condition of not adjusting the pH value of the solution, the content of rhodamine B in the aqueous phase was determined after vortex centrifugation. According to the measurement result, it can be known that the hydrophobic deep eutectic solvents of all different mol ratios prepared have an extraction effect on rhodamine B, and when the mol ratio of lidocaine and n-octyl p-hydroxybenzoate in the hydrophobic deep eutectic solvent is When the ratio is 1:2, the extraction rate of Rhodamine B in Rhodamine B aqueous solution is as high as 99%.

Embodiment 3

[0029] Weigh a certain amount of the hydrophobic deep eutectic solvent synthesized in Example 1 respectively in a certain amount of methyl violet aqueous solution with a concentration of 10 mg / L. Under the condition of not adjusting the pH value of the solution, the content of methyl violet in the aqueous phase was determined after vortex centrifugation. According to the measurement result, it can be known that the hydrophobic deep eutectic solvents of all different mol ratios prepared have an extraction effect on methyl violet, and when the mol ratio of lidocaine and n-octyl p-hydroxybenzoate in the hydrophobic deep eutectic solvent is When the ratio is 1:1, the extraction rate of methyl violet in the methyl violet aqueous solution is as high as 97%.

Abstract

The invention discloses a hydrophobic low-eutectic-point solvent based on lidocaine and a preparation method and extraction application of the solvent, and belongs to the technical field of extraction, separation and enrichment of large cationic compounds. The hydrophobic low-eutectic-point solvent based on lidocaine is characterized in that the hydrophobic low-eutectic-point solvent is synthesized from lidocaine serving as a hydrogen bond acceptor and n-octyl p-hydroxybenzoate serving as a hydrogen bond donor in the molar ratio of 1:(0.25-3). The invention particularly discloses the preparation method of the hydrophobic low-eutectic-point solvent based on lidocaine and application of the solvent in extraction of rhodamine B, methyl violet or/and malachite green in an aqueous solution. When used as an extraction agent, the prepared hydrophobic low-eutectic-point solvent has the advantages of being easy to synthesize, stable in performance, low in toxicity, high in extraction efficiency and the like.

technical field [0001] The invention belongs to the technical field of extraction, separation and enrichment of large cationic compounds, and in particular relates to a lidocaine-based hydrophobic deep eutectic solvent, a preparation method thereof, and an extraction application. Background technique [0002] A deep eutectic solvent usually refers to a mixture of two or more substances formed by hydrogen bonding, whose melting point is lower than that of each component and which is liquid at room temperature. Deep eutectic solvent is a new type of green solvent. It not only has the advantages of low vapor pressure of ionic liquid, good electrical and thermal conductivity, low melting point, wide liquid range, and strong thermal stability, but also has the advantages of low price, simple preparation, and no need for Further purification and other advantages.
